Do you have a hard time to sleep when it's too hot? Or do you have a workplace where it's too muggy to get anything done? The best portable a/c unit (PAC) will keep a single space cool in the hot summertime, with no disruptive setup required and at a much lower expense than house-wide systems.
You can even move them around, with some restrictions, so the same unit that cools your house office in the day can also keep your bedroom chilled at night. PACs aren't inexpensive: most expense someplace in between 300 and 1,000. Listed below this price, you tend to discover evaporative air coolers instead of true a/c, which aren't as reliable.
PACs are ranked in British thermal units (BTU): one BTU is the amount of heat required to raise the temperature of one pound of water by one degree. A higher score implies an air conditioning unit can cool a larger area, which normally implies the unit itself will be bigger and more expensive.
Measure your space before you buy to ensure you pick an a/c unit that depends on the job. Of course, you do not wish to go much bigger than you have to. Weight, size and convenience matter, and if a system's too huge, too heavy and too challenging to set up, then you may end up preventing using it other than for a couple of truly hot days in the summer.
Positioning is another concern: most PACs need to vent hot air through a window, and if you can't position it ideal beside an ideal opening, you will either need to put an irreversible vent through the wall or find a design with a tube extender (daikin wall controller). The majority of PACs will include a window repairing set to block any gap, however this might just be suitable for a sash window, sliding door or hinged top window. While you might be able to improvise with hardboard or towels, it makes good sense to check what options you have offered for your selected PAC before you get it house.
As the air cools, wetness condenses out of it, which is collected inside the PAC. Some systems can vaporize this internally and tire it through the hose or the back of the system; in other models, it's kept in an internal reservoir that needs to be emptied by hand. Keep an eye out for sleep modes, too. These power down the compressor and reduce the speed of any fans to make the PAC's hum a little easier to sleep through. If you actually deal with the sound, however, think of cooling the room prior to you go to sleep, or attempt using a desktop or pedestal fan rather.
Your air conditioner need to have an energy performance class, from A++ down to G, simply like your fridge or cooker. The greater the class, the more effective the system will be.
